The Unshakable Value of Human Creativity in a World of AI🌍

As AI tools like GitHub Copilot and ChatGPT redefine how we write code, a pressing question arises: Will machines replace programmers? The answer lies not in the code itself, but in the uniquely human skills that fuel innovation. Coding isn’t just syntax—it’s the art of translating abstract ideas into logical systems, a process that demands creativity, critical thinking, and adaptability. While AI excels at automating repetitive tasks, it stumbles when faced with ambiguity, ethical dilemmas, or the need for original problem-solving. Consider this: 87% of AI-generated code requires human intervention to fix security flaws or logic errors, according to a 2023 Stanford study. This gap underscores why coders aren’t disappearing—they’re evolving into architects of AI’s potential.When you learn to code, you train your brain to solve problems logically, break down complexity, and build systems that reflect human intent. AI, for all its brilliance, lacks the intuition to navigate ambiguity, ethical dilemmas, or the messy reality of real-world problems. A recent MIT study found that developers using AI tools spent 30% more time debugging flawed code than those writing it manually. This gap reveals a truth: AI is a collaborator, not a replacement.

đź§ Coding as a Gateway to Computational Fluency

At its heart, programming teaches computational thinking—a way of dissecting challenges that transcends technology. This skill is why epidemiologists use Python to model disease outbreaks, why architects simulate sustainable cities with algorithms, and why artists create generative art through code. It’s not about memorizing syntax; it’s about learning to see the world through the lens of logic and possibility. 🤝 The Evolution of Tech Careers: From Coders to Architects

The fear that AI will erase entry-level coding jobs misunderstands how technology evolves. Yes, AI automates repetitive tasks—like generating boilerplate code—but it also creates new roles. Developers are now “AI trainers,” refining models to avoid bias. They’re “prompt engineers,” crafting precise instructions to guide AI outputs. They’re “ethical automation designers,” ensuring algorithms align with human values. LinkedIn’s 2024 Workforce Report shows a 180% spike in jobs requiring AI collaboration skills, with salaries 40% higher than traditional tech roles. Junior developers aren’t being replaced; they’re being upskilled. 🛠️ Adaptability: The Hidden Skill Coders Master

The tech landscape evolves at breakneck speed, and coding teaches you to adapt. Languages fade, frameworks rise, and tools like AI redefine workflows—but the ability to learn, unlearn, and relearn remains timeless. Consider how developers transitioned from monolithic systems to cloud-native architectures, or how blockchain pioneers repurposed cryptographic principles for decentralized apps.
